دیجی اسکریپت

باکس دانلود Archives | دیجی اسکریپت

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or
[ad_1]

اگر در وب سایت وردپرسی خود فایل های مختلفی را برای دانلود قرار می دهید، می توانید با ساخت باکس دانلود در وردپرس برای هر فایل دانلودی، یک باکس جداگانه طراحی کرده و تعداد دانلودهای آن را نیز نمایش دهید.

 

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

 

به طور پیش فرض امکان دانلود فایل برای کاربران با کلیک راست وجود خواهد داشت، اما ممکن است فایل های شما حجم بیشتری داشته و نیاز به ایجاد دکمه دانلود فایل داشته باشید. در این آموزش ازبیست اسکریپت افزونه ای کاربردی را برای ساخت باکس دانلود در وردپرس معرفی خواهم کرد و نحوه ایجاد جعبه های دانلود را آموزش خواهم داد.

 

آموزش ساخت باکس دانلود در وردپرس

افزونه ای که در این آموزش برای ایجاد جعبه های دانلود معرفی می کنم، با عنوان Simple Download Monitor در مخزن وردپرس به ثبت رسیده است. این افزونه تا کنون با بیش از ۲۰٫۰۰۰ نصب فعال توانسته است امتیاز ۴٫۴ را از کاربران خود به دست بیاورد.

 

برای ساخت باکس دانلود در وردپرس، با کلیک روی دکمه زیر این افزونه را از مخزن وردپرس دانلود کرده و سپس به کمک آموزش نحوه نصب افزونه ها در وردپرس اقدام به نصب و فعال سازی آن در وب سایت خود نمایید.

پس از نصب و فعال سازی افزونه منویی با عنوان Downloads در پیشخوان وب سایت شما ظاهر می شود که با کلیک روی آن به صفحه باکس های دانلود ایجاد شده هدایت خواهید شد.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

برای ساخت باکس دانلود در وردپرس در این صفحه روی دکمه Add New کلیک کنید.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

همانطور که مشاهده می کنید در این صفحه می توانید برای باکس دانلود خود عنوان و توضیحات کوتاهی وارد کنید تا قبل از دانلود به کاربر نمایش داده شود.

  • در بخش Downloadable File، فایلی که می خواهید کاربران پس از ساخت باکس دانلود در وردپرس بتوانند دانلود کنند، انتخاب نمایید و یا آدرس آن را وارد کنید.
  • در این صفحه با فعال سازی گزینه PHP Dispatch or Redirect، آدرس محل قرارگیری فایل دانلودی شما مخفی خواهد شد.
  • در بخش Miscellaneous Download Item Properties می توانید ویژگی هایی مانند باز شدن لینک دانلود در صفحه جدید و … را فعال یا غیرفعال کنید.
  • برای ساخت باکس دانلود در وردپرس در بخش File Thumbnail، یک تصویر بندانگشتی مناسب انتخاب کنید.
  • در بخش Statistics نیز می توانید تعداد دانلود فایل را برای نمایش در باکس دانلود وارد کرده و سایر جزئیات از قبیل اندازه فایل، تاریخ انتشار، ورژن، متن دکمه دانلود و … را نیز در بخش Other Details وارد کنید.
  • در نهایت پس از ذخیره تغییرات می توانید از شورت کدهای نمایش داده شده در بخش Shortcodes برای نمایش باکس دانلود ساخته شده استفاده کنید.
  • همچنین برای ساخت باکس دانلود در وردپرس می توانید برای باکس های خود دسته بندی در زیرمنوی Categories و برچسب در زیرمنوی Tags انتخاب کنید.

پس از ساخت باکس دانلود در وردپرس با کلیک روی دکمه انتشار می توانید از آن در برگه های خود استفاده کنید. برای این منظور به صفحه ایجاد برگه در وردپرس رفته و چنانچه از ویرایشگر گوتنبرگ استفاده می کنید، بلوک SDM Download را اضافه نمایید.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

همانطور که در تصویر زیر مشاهده می کنید، پس از افزودن بلوک می توانید از بین آیتم های دانلودی که پیش از این ساخته اید یکی را انتخاب کرده، قالب مورد نظر، رنگ دکمه دانلود و متن آن را به دلخواه تغییر دهید.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

پس از ساخت باکس دانلود در وردپرس می توانید به دلخواه خود آن را در صفحات مختلف به نمایش در بیاورید.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

علاوه بر تمام بخش های توضیح داده شده، افزونه Simple Download Monitor دارای دو زیرمنوی دیگر با عنوان های Setting و Add-ons نیز می باشد.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

در بخش تنظیمات افزونه می توانید برای ساخت باکس دانلود در وردپرس تنظیماتی از قبیل دانلود فقط برای کاربران ثبت نام شده، مخفی کردن تعداد دانلود ها، رنگ، فعال سازی کپچای گوگل، فعال سازی نقشه گوگل، تبلیغات و … را مدیریت کنید.

آ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or

در بخش Add-ons نیز می توانید اضافات افزونه را مشاهده و در صورت تمایل دانلود و نصب نمایید.

با ساخت باکس دانلود در وردپرس می توانید دانلود فایل های خود را حرفه ای تر کرده و وب سایت های دانلودی مانند freepik را با وردپرس راه اندازی کنید.

نوشته آموزش ساخت باکس دانلود در وردپرس با افزونه Simple Download Monitor اولین بار در بیست اسکریپت. پدیدار شد.

[ad_2]

لینک منبع مطلب

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field
[ad_1]

یک وبسایت دانلود مهم ترین بخش اون میتونه ساخت جعبه دانلود در وردپرس باشه , چرا که مطمئنن کاربر برای دانلود باید یک بخش مشخص شده ای را ببیند و اقدام به دانلود فایل نماید . در این آموزش وردپرس به شما ساخت باکس دانلود در وردپرس را آموزش میدهیم .

 

ساخت جعبه دانلود در وردپرس

ساخت جعبه دانلود وردپرس هم با افزونه قابل اجرا هستش و هم بدون افزونه اما در این اموزش به شما نحوه ساخت جعبه دانلود با استفاده از افزونه را آموزش خواهیم داد , چرا که این افزونه هم سبک و کاربری آسان دارد و هم ظاهری مناسب جهت مدیریت فیلد های ایجاد شده .

 

 

این افزونه با نام زمینه های دلخواه وردپرس Advanced Custom Field در مخزن وردپرس با بیش از یک میلیون نصب فعال یکی از محبوب ترین افزونه های حال حاضر میباشد که با استفاده از این افزونه میتوانید هر نوع فیلدی را در نوشته های خود ایجاد کرده و به راحتی استفاده کنید .

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

این افزونه بصورت اختصاصی در بیست اسکریپت معرفی شده و آموزش چگونگی کارکرد این افزونه هم انتشار داده شده است . برای شروع ما یک چند فیلد ایجاد میکنیم که به راحتی میتوانید به ایجاد باکس دانلود در وردپرس بپردازید .

 

اول از هر چیزی بهتر است مشخص کنید که جایگاه باکس دانلود شما در کدام بخش از ادامه مطلب باشد .

 

نکته : برای اضافه کردن باکس دانلود در قالب بصورت پیشفرض فایل single.php میباشد .

 

بعد از مشخص کردن جایگاه مناسب باکس دانلود افزونه Advanced Custom Fields رو نصب و فعال نمائید .

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

بعد از نصب و فعال سازی افزونه گزینه ای به نام زمینه های دلخواه در پیشخوان وردپرس اضافه میشود .

بعد از کلیک بر روی این گزینه به تنظیمات این افزونه هدایت میشوید .

 

ساخت گروه زمینه دلخواه

در ادامه برای ساخت یک باکس فیلد بر روی افزودن کلیک نمائید .

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

با کلیک بر روی گزینه افزودن به صفحه ی ایجاد زمینه دلخواه میریم که شما در واقع میتوانید تمام بخش های زمینه دلخواه خود را در این بخش مدیریت کنید .

خوب در ادامه تمام بخش های ایجاد زمینه دلخواه رو خدمت شما توضیح میدهیم .

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

  • ۱ – یک عنوان مناسب برای گروه خود انتخاب کنید .
  • ۲ – یک عنوان مناسب برای برچسب خود انتخاب کنید .
  • ۳ – نام یا همان متا دیتای خود را وارد کنید . مثال : url_downlaod , size , format و …
  • ۴ – نوع زمینه را انتخاب کنید زمینه شما میتواند بارگزاری پرونده باشه , متن باشه , دکمه رادیویی و یا هر فیلد مناسب کار شما .
  • ۵ – در اینجا میتوانید توضیحات لازم جهت درج مقدار این زمینه وارد کنید تا هنگام مقدار دهی نویسنده شما به این بخش توجه به نکات گفته شده کند .
  • ۶ – از نامش مشخص است یک مقدار اولیه وارد کنید چنان چه مقداری به زمینه داده نشد این مقدار اولیه به نمایش در بی آید .
  • ۷ – نگهدارنده متن در واقع همان placeholder میباشد که دستورالعمل کوتاه داخل فیلد به نمایش در می آید .
  • ۸ – مقداری که قبل از هر زمینه به نمایش در می آید .
  • ۹ – مقداری که بعد از هر زمینه به نمایش در می آید .
  • ۱۰ – نوع قالب بندی در واقع شیوه نمایش مقدار زمینه در قالب را مشخص میکند .
  • ۱۱ – در این بخش میتوانید برای درج مقدار محدودیت قرار دهید .
  • ۱۲ – ایا این فیلد الزامی میباشد یا خیر .
  • ۱۳ – این زمینه ها در چه پست تایپی به نمایش در بیاید (page یا post) و یا دیگر پست تایپ ها .
  • ۱۴ – موقعیت باکس زمینه های دلخواه کجا باشید .
  • ۱۵ – شیوه نمیاش که بهتر است بر روی استاندارد دارای باکس قرار گیرد .

و در انتها میتوانید با کلیک بر روی دکمه انتشار گروه زمینه دلخواه خود را ایجاد کنید .

خوب در اینجا شما به تمامی بخش ساخت فیلد آشنایی پیدا کردید در واقع بعد از مطالعه این چند مورد به راحتی میتوانید چندین فیلد ایجاد کنید و به راحتی در بخش نوشته ها مقدار فیلدهای خود را مدیریت کنید .

 

نمونه فید های ایجاد شده باکس دانلود

در زیر چند فیلد نمونه ایجاد کرده ایم و قرار است کد های فراخونی آن را در قالب درج کنیم .

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

در تصویر بالا ما سه فیلد مهم برای جعبه دانلود ایجاد کردیم یکی نام فایل , آدرس دانلود فایل و حجم فایل , که در واقع بعد از انتشار میتوانید این زمینه های دلخواه را در نوشته های خود مشاهده کنید .

طبق تصویر زیر :

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

حال قرار است فیلد های بالا در قالب ما به شکل تصویر زیر در بیایند .

آ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field

قبل از هر چیزی باید کد های فراخونی شده فیلد ها و زمینه های دلخواه را در قالب قرار دهیم .

کد زیر را در بخش مورد نیاز و مشخص شده بین کدهای قالب وردپرس خود قرار دهید :

<div class="box-download">

<h4> مشخصات دانلود </h4>
	<ul>
	
		<li>
			<?php if(get_post_meta($post->ID, "namefile", true)) {?>
			<b> نام فایل : </b>
			<a href="<?php echo get_post_meta($post->ID, 'dlfile', true); ?>">
			<?php echo get_post_meta($post->ID, 'namefile', true); ?>
			</a>

			<?php } else {?>
<!-- اگر زمینه دلخواه رو خالی گذاشتیم این رو نشون بده  -->				
			<?php }?>
		</li>
		<li>
			<?php if(get_post_meta($post->ID, "sizefile", true)) {?>
			<b> حجم فایل : </b>
			<?php echo get_post_meta($post->ID, 'sizefile', true); ?>

			<?php } else {?>
<!-- اگر زمینه دلخواه رو خالی گذاشتیم این رو نشون بده  -->				
			<?php }?>
		</li>
		<li>
			<p> بیست اسکریپت / www.20script.ir </p>
		</li>

	</ul>
</div>

کد بالا بخشی از کد های php و html جهت نمایش زمینه دلخواه ایجاد شده در نوشته های وردپرسی شما میباشد .

نکته : در کد بالا زمینه های دلخواه ممکن است برای شما متفاوت باشد این کد مربوط به بخش نام زمینه * در هنگام ساخت زمینه دلخواه میباشد .

 

استایل دهی به جعبه دانلود وردپرس

برای اینکه بخواهیم استایل مناسب طبق تصویر بالا به کد هایمان دهیم کافیست کد css زیر را در استایل خود کپی کرده و ذخیر کنید و تغییرات رو با استفاده از کلید ترکیبی ctrl+f5 مشاهده نمائید .

.box-download{
  background: #e4f3f2;
  border-radius: 5px;
  padding: 5px;
  float: right;
  width: 100%;
}
.box-download h4{
  width: 100%;
  float: right;
  text-align: right;
}
.box-download ul{
  padding: 0px !important;
  margin: 0px !important;
  list-style: none;
}
.box-download ul li{
  float: right;
  width: 100%;
  margin: 5px 0px;
}
.box-download ul li b{
  font-weight: bold;
}
.box-download ul li p{
  margin: 0px;
  padding: 0px !important;
}

با ایجاد و اعمال کد های بالا به درستی موفق به ایجاد باکس دانلود در وردپرس شده اید .

موفق و پیروز باشید

نوشته آموزش ساخت جعبه دانلود حرفه ای در وردپرس به وسیله Advanced Custom Field اولین بار در بیست اسکریپت. پدیدار شد.

[ad_2]

لینک منبع مطلب

کد جعبه دانلود ساده
[ad_1]

جعبه دانلود مشخصا برای قرار دادن لینک دانلود و مشخصات مثل حجم فایل و منبع فایل در آن به نمایش گذاشته می شود . در این مطلب از بیست اسکریپت کد جعبه دانلود بسیار ساده ای آماده استفاده کرده ایم که توسط آن قادر خواهید بود در وب سایت خود و یا وبلاگ از این جعبه بسیار زیبا و کاربردی استفاده نمایید این جعبه دانلود کاملا واکنش گرا می باشد و در تمامی مرورگر ها قابل استفاده است. در ادامه می توانید این کد کاربردی را دریافت نمایید با ما همراه باشید

 

کد جعبه دانلود ساده

دریافت کد:

<link rel="stylesheet" type="text/css" href="http://dl.20script.ir/tools/box-dl-classic/CSS.css">
<div id="bistscript" style="font-family: 'B Yekan'; font-size: 13px;">
 <div id="bist-script-ir" style="direction: rtl;border-top-right-radius: 20px; height: auto; background-color: rgba(0, 0, 0, 0.027451);">
   <div class="bist-script" style="border-top-left-radius: 20px; width: 56px; border-top-right-radius: 20px; padding-right: 20px; color: rgb(0, 0, 0); padding-left: 20px; background-color: rgba(0, 0, 0, 0.0980392);"> جعبه دانلود </div>
  
<div class="dl-bistscript" style="background-image: url(http://dl.20script.ir/tools/box-dl-classic/3.png);">
 
  <a href="http://www.20script.ir">برای دانلود اینجا کلیک کنید</a> 
</div>
<div class="dl-bistscript" style="background-image: url(http://dl.20script.ir/tools/box-dl-classic/4.png);">
 
  <a herf="adredd">سازنده و منبع کد : بیست اسکریپت</a> 
</div>
<div class="dl-bistscript" style="background-image: url(http://dl.20script.ir/tools/box-dl-classic/2.png);">
 
  <a herf="adredd">رمز : www.20script.ir</a> 
</div>
<div class="dl-bistscript" style="background-image: url(http://dl.20script.ir/tools/box-dl-classic/1.png);">
  <a herf="adredd">کپی برداری حتی با ذکر منبع غیرمجار می باشد</a> 
</div></div>

موفق باشید

نوشته کد جعبه دانلود ساده اولین بار در بیست اسکریپت. پدیدار شد.

[ad_2]

لینک منبع مطلب